The median home value in Colerain, NC is $167,812. This is higher than the county median home value of $90,000. The national median home value is $308,980. The average price of homes sold in Colerain, NC is $167,812. Approximately 56% of Colerain homes are owned, compared to 24% rented, while 20% are vacant. Not many 1820 homes come on the market and certainly not as pretty as this one. This two-story Greek Revival-style house, known as the Henry Beasley House, c. 1820 is sheathed with weatherboard and filled with charm and character. The two panel entrance door is surrounded by transom and sidelights. The first floor windows are nine-over-nine double-hung sash and the second floor windows are nine-over-six, most with original wavy glass, with fluted surrounds and Greek key motifs at the corners. Heart pine floors throughout all the main areas are in great condition showing off the natural beauty in the wood. The center hall/foyer is wide with high ceilings and plenty of room for displaying large antiques. The formal living areas on each side of the front door offer plenty of entertaining space with beautiful architectural features. A new chimney has been built on the left side, which helps set up the spectacular over 6' tall ornate mantle. The fireplace on the right side/den area is currently being used for a wood-burning fireplace. The large formal dining room features a ceiling medallion with prominent hanging chandelier. This room is perfect for entertaining a large gathering. The kitchen on the back has been recently renovated to include new appliances and island. Upstairs can be accessed from the back entrance or from the front foyer. Here you'll find 4 large bedrooms, tons of natural light, a full bath with access to the upstairs front hall and the back landing. The laundry room is located downstairs off the kitchen. Outside features includes a beautifully crafted water feature, 5' tall black coated chainlink fence, and a two-bay, two-story garage with workshop. Protective covenants are attached to the deed with Preservation NC. This is a contributing building in Colerain's National register Historic District, making it eligible for historic tax credits.
